Local signal detection is useful in many scientific areas such as imaging processing and speech recognition, for extracting meaningful patterns from noisy signals. Missing data is one of the major methodological problems in longitudinal studies. It not only reduces the sample size, but also can result in biased estimation and inference. We consider two semiparametric regression models for data analysis, the stochastic additive model (SAM) for nonlinear time series data and the additive coefficient model (ACM) for randomly sampled data with nonparametric structure. Monotone additive models are useful in estimating productivity curves or analyzing disease risk where the predictors are known to have monotonic effects on the response. A copula is the representation of a multivariate distribution. Copulas are used to model multivariate data in many fields. Recent developments include copula models for spatial data and for discrete marginals. Species diversification in aquaculture has been driven and influenced by various factors including consumer preference, technical innovations such as advances in artificial propagation, economies of scale, risk diversification, policy orientation, among others. Diffusion processes in networks are common models for many domains, including species colonization, information/idea cascade, disease propagation and fire spreading. Cubic phase Li₇La₃Zr₂O₁₂ (LLZO) is a promising solid electrolyte for all solid-state lithium-ion battery, due to its reasonable ionic conductivity, stable against metallic Li, wide chemical window, and thermal and chemical stability. Increasing grain yield in wheat (Triticum aestivum L.) is a challenging task, because yield is a complex trait controlled by many genes and highly influenced by environmental factors.
